
Eddie Gallimore
Republican | North Carolina
Candidate Profile
Leans Conservative
BIOGRAPHY
Name
Eddie Gallimore
Party
Republican
Election Year
2022
Election
Primary
Race
State Senate, Dist. 30
Incumbent
No
EDUCATION
Davidson-Davie Community College, Lexington, Associates, 1989
WORK & MILITARY
Candidate did not provide
AFFILIATIONS
Pleasant Grove United Methodist Church, Tabernacle United Methodist Church
Davidson County Republican Party, Executive Board Member 2005-2009, Vice Chair 2009-2013
Davidson County Tea Party, President 2012-2018, 6th US Congressional District
POLITICAL OFFICES HELD
North Carolina State Senate District 29, 2019-2020
POLITICAL OFFICES SOUGHT
Davidson County Commissioner, 2008/2010
North Carolina State Senate, 2012/2014/2016/2018/2020

QUESTIONNAIRE
RIGHT TO LIFE
Under what circumstances should abortion be allowed?
This is a very difficult question to address. I know there should be a "YES or NO" answer. Before you judge me on my answer, first answer it for yourself and please think of all different things that could have happened for a woman to be in this place and time in her life. As a male I can never know the feeling of giving birth, only a woman by birth herself can give birth. I know without a doubt that life begins when the egg is fertilized (ie. conception)!. If man takes that life in anyway he is killing a human. I can say that I would not take abortion off the table in some cases but it would have to be were the mother was going to die and the child was knowingly going to die. There are other circumstances, that I not being in the medical field do not know about, when the decision will have to be made at that moment in time. I can honestly say I hope to never be put in this situation.
Abortion providers, including Planned Parenthood, should not receive funds from federal, state, or local governments (including Title X grants).
Strongly Agree
Tax money should not be used for this at all.
If Roe v. Wade is overturned by the US Supreme Court, how far are you willing to go to roll back North Carolina's statutory abortion law that allows abortion up to 20 weeks?
I am opposed to abortion. It is the taking of human life. Now it is not my right to judge others. Each case is different and all matters must be weighed individually. This is not between Roe v. Wade nor men, It is between a woman and God. 20 weeks or 20 seconds it is the same.

ABOUT YOU
What do you think is the general purpose of government?
Federal - To protect and up hold The Constitution Of The United States. Protect the borders and America from foreign attacks. The list goes on. State - To protect and up hold The Constitution Of North Carolina. draft and pass state budget, draw up bills and make laws. Their purpose goes on but that is only a start.
When you consider your views on a wide range of issues from economic and social matters to foreign policy and religious liberty, which of the following best describes you overall?
Very Conservative
Please provide publicly available information, including interviews and media reports, validating your answer to the previous question (other than your website).
Reading what I have stated here in should verify.
Have you ever been convicted of a felony or been penalized in either civil or criminal court for sexual misconduct? If so, please explain.
No
What else would you like voters to know about you, including your legislative priorities?
I am not a polished career politician, nor a yes men when it comes to speaking on my beliefs. I will fight and stand up for what is right and the people. I am a Life Member and have been endorsed by the NRA in the past. I am a Concealed Carry Handgun Instructor. I am a Davidson County Native. As Senator my goals are to shrink government and remove restrictions from individuals as well as industry. To strive in making the government more user friendly when you have to do business directly with different departments ie. DMV, Wildlife, Social Services, etc.
